Monster cables are the best cables you can get. If you don't think that the extra shielding makes a differencec, than you just haven't seen a side-by-side comparison between monster cables and regular "shielded" cables.

Regular compenent is still good, don't get me wrong, but you can notice a difference between the highest quality monster (THX) vs. monsters regular compentent cable... and you can really notice a difference between THX and other brands regular component cables...

Now, there is the issue of diminishing returns with the higher priced monster. The higher the quality cable, the smaller the improvement, and the higher the price.

Oh, and Monster cables are guaranteed for life. So if you buy a great pair of cables, you can use them as long as possible.

But, if spending $20-$50 extra bucks to get a incrementally less better picture isn't for you, than don't bother. But don't post as if monster cables don't make a difference if that's what you were trying to do.
